Great Tool... as I always say, the XR oscillating tool is probably the best tool Dewalt has. It truly crushes other brands.

But I need another bag and weak battery/charger like I need a fresh kidney stone. Lol.

The 1.3ah, and 1.5ah are such bizarre batteries. They are great for using as a portable charger in a backpack, or truck, but in tools they're 💩. Lol.

At least give us the low profile 3ah. I like the low profiles because of the wider base. They are less tippy for drills.

Now if only Dewalt mad a 9ah low profile... lol, it'd be like a 13" iron skillet on your tool. Lol.

Quote from IncompletePerfect :
Great Tool... as I always say, the XR oscillating tool is probably the best tool Dewalt has. It truly crushes other brands.

But I need another bag and weak battery/charger like I need a fresh kidney stone. Lol.

The 1.3ah, and 1.5ah are such bizarre batteries. They are great for using as a portable charger in a backpack, or truck, but in tools they're 💩. Lol.
Agreed, I bought into same deal maybe 7 days ago.. product just arrived and tested over the weekend.. tried to remove some tile grouts, the 1.5Ah is just not enough juice to do the job.. i think it ran 5 min the first time and then i had to wait 1-2 min before the trigger will work again (I thought battery is drained).. funny thing is i put battery back on charger, it shows solid LED red meaning its' full, I took battery off from charger and tried again, , each trigger pull prob gave me 2-3 seconds of action...

Is this a defective battery ? Any thought on a 4.0 or 5.0 Ah Amazon non-Dewalt brand from China? Them any good ?
